20 animals seized from Butler County home

Pennsylvania State Police in Butler seized 10 dogs, one cat, four ducks and five chickens from a home in Muddy Creek Township, Butler County, on Monday.

Troopers were called to the 300 block of Pfeifer Road for reports of 10 dogs living in “deplorable conditions.”

The house was declared “uninhabitable,” police said.

An investigation is ongoing.
